If you're struggling with this error and need immediate help, call +1-800-223-1608, and our QuickBooks support team will guide you through the necessary steps to fix this error efficiently. Let’s take a closer look at the reasons behind QuickBooks Error 4001, its impact, and how you can resolve it with the help of expert assistance.
What is QuickBooks Error 4001?
QuickBooks Error 4001 typically occurs during online payment processing, especially when using features like QuickBooks Payments or processing payments through your QuickBooks Merchant Services. When this error occurs, the error message will indicate that QuickBooks is unable to complete or process a transaction, often due to network or server-related problems.
The error message you will see might say:
“QuickBooks Error 4001: Payment failed to process.”
This issue can halt your ability to process payments, impacting your business’s cash flow and leading to significant delays in completing transactions. If you experience this error, it’s important to resolve it quickly so that you can continue managing your finances without any disruptions.
Call +1-800-223-1608 to speak with a QuickBooks expert who can help you resolve Error 4001 promptly.
Why Does QuickBooks Error 4001 Occur?
Understanding the reasons behind QuickBooks Error 4001 will help you troubleshoot and fix the issue more effectively. Here are some of the most common reasons:
1. Network Connectivity Issues
Network disruptions or slow internet connections can interfere with QuickBooks’ ability to process payments. When your network is unstable or not connected, QuickBooks might not be able to communicate with the payment gateway, triggering Error 4001.
2. Incompatible or Outdated QuickBooks Version
Running an outdated version of QuickBooks can cause compatibility issues with QuickBooks Payments and other services. If QuickBooks isn't up to date, it may fail to connect to the payment processing services, leading to QuickBooks Error 4001.
3. Payment Gateway Issues
If you are using an external payment gateway, such as QuickBooks Payments, to process credit card payments, any server-side issues with the gateway can cause Error 4001. If the gateway is temporarily down or not responding, QuickBooks cannot process payments.
4. Configuration Issues in QuickBooks
Incorrect configurations or settings within QuickBooks, particularly with payment processing features, can trigger Error 4001. For example, if your merchant account settings are not set up correctly, QuickBooks won’t be able to process payments, resulting in this error.
5. Security Software Blocking QuickBooks
Firewalls, antivirus software, or other security tools may block QuickBooks from accessing online payment services, causing Error 4001. These programs can prevent QuickBooks from establishing a secure connection to the payment gateway, leading to a failure in processing payments.
Frequently Asked Questions (FAQs) About QuickBooks Error 4001
1. What is QuickBooks Error 4001 and why does it occur?
QuickBooks Error 4001 occurs when QuickBooks is unable to process a payment due to connectivity issues, outdated software, incorrect configurations, or server issues. It typically happens while processing transactions through QuickBooks Payments or other integrated payment services.
2. How do I fix QuickBooks Error 4001?
To fix QuickBooks Error 4001, follow these steps:
- Check your internet connection to ensure it is stable and fast enough for online payments.
- Update QuickBooks to the latest version to ensure compatibility with QuickBooks Payments.
- Verify your merchant account settings and make sure they are configured correctly.
- Temporarily disable firewall and antivirus software to check if they are blocking QuickBooks.
- Contact your payment gateway provider if there is a server-side issue affecting payments.
3. Can I fix QuickBooks Error 4001 by updating QuickBooks?
Yes, updating QuickBooks to the latest version can resolve Error 4001. If you’re using an outdated version, QuickBooks may not be compatible with the current payment processing services, resulting in errors. Ensure your software is up-to-date by navigating to Help > Update QuickBooks.
4. How does network connectivity affect QuickBooks Error 4001?
If your network connection is unstable, QuickBooks may not be able to communicate with the payment gateway. A weak or disconnected internet connection will prevent payment processing, causing Error 4001.
5. What should I do if the payment gateway is down?
If Error 4001 is caused by issues with the payment gateway, there’s little you can do other than wait for the issue to be resolved by the gateway provider. Check the payment gateway's website for updates or contact their support team.
6. How do I configure QuickBooks to process payments correctly?
To ensure QuickBooks processes payments without issues, verify your merchant account settings and ensure everything is configured correctly. You can also recheck your QuickBooks Payments setup by going to Settings > Payments and confirming the integration.
How to Fix QuickBooks Error 4001
Resolving QuickBooks Error 4001 requires a systematic approach to troubleshooting. Here are the key steps to follow:
1. Verify Your Network Connection
A stable and fast network connection is crucial for QuickBooks to communicate with payment gateways. If your internet connection is slow or unreliable, QuickBooks may be unable to process payments. To troubleshoot:
- Ensure your internet connection is working properly.
- Restart your modem/router to clear any temporary network issues.
- Try connecting to a different network to rule out local network problems.
2. Update QuickBooks to the Latest Version
Running an outdated version of QuickBooks can cause compatibility issues with payment processing services. To update QuickBooks:
- Open QuickBooks and go to Help > Update QuickBooks.
- Click Update Now and follow the prompts to download and install the latest updates.
- After updating, restart QuickBooks and check if the error persists.
3. Check Your Merchant Account Settings
Incorrect configuration of your QuickBooks Payments settings can trigger Error 4001. Follow these steps to verify your settings:
- Open QuickBooks and go to Settings > Payments.
- Verify that your merchant account is connected and configured correctly.
- If necessary, disconnect and reconnect your merchant account to reset the configuration.
4. Disable Firewall and Antivirus Temporarily
Sometimes, firewalls and antivirus software can block QuickBooks from connecting to the payment gateway. Temporarily disable your firewall and antivirus to see if that resolves the issue:
- Open your antivirus or firewall settings.
- Temporarily disable the firewall and antivirus software.
- Try processing a payment again to see if the issue is resolved.
If disabling the firewall fixes the error, you’ll need to add QuickBooks to your firewall’s list of allowed programs.
5. Contact Your Payment Gateway Provider
If Error 4001 is due to server issues with your payment gateway, contact the payment provider’s support team. Ask them if there are any ongoing server-side issues affecting payment processing.
Conclusion
QuickBooks Error 4001 can disrupt your ability to process payments and manage your business finances. However, by following the troubleshooting steps outlined in this article, you can quickly resolve the error and resume normal operations.
If you need further assistance or can't resolve the error on your own, don’t hesitate to call +1-800-223-1608. Our QuickBooks support team is available to provide expert guidance and solutions tailored to your specific issue.